Choosing the Right Plants

Selecting the right plants is the cornerstone of creating a successful indoor night garden. Some plants that flourish in low-light conditions include:

  • Snake Plants (Sansevieria)
  • ZZ Plants (Zamioculcas zamiifolia)
  • Peace Lilies (Spathiphyllum)
  • Pothos (Epipremnum aureum)
  • Cast Iron Plants (Aspidistra elatior)
  • Boston Ferns (Nephrolepis exaltata)

Designing Your Garden

Once you've selected your plants, it's time to design your garden. Consider the following factors:

  • Lighting: Use soft, warm lighting to mimic natural moonlight. LED strip lights or fairy lights can create a magical atmosphere.
  • Color Scheme: Choose plants with varying textures and shades of green to create visual interest.
  • Layout: Arrange plants in layers, with taller plants at the back and shorter ones in front, to create depth and dimension.

Caring for Your Night Garden

Maintaining an indoor night garden requires minimal effort. Here are some care tips:

  • Water your plants sparingly, allowing the soil to dry out between waterings.
  • Fertilize once a year, using a balanced, water-soluble fertilizer.
  • Dust can accumulate on leaves, blocking sunlight. Gently clean leaves with a damp cloth as needed.
